What companies run services between Belfast, Northern Ireland and Kenmore, Perth and Kinross, Scotland?

There is no direct connection from Belfast to Kenmore. However, you can take the line 96 bus to Stena Line terminus, walk to Port Of Belfast, take the car ferry to Cairnryan, walk to Stena Terminal, take the bus to Buchanan Bus Station, take the bus to Park and Ride, then take the taxi to Kenmore. Alternatively, you can take a train from Lanyon Place to Kenmore via Larne Harbour, Larne, Cairnryan, Stranraer, Ayr, Glasgow Central, Glasgow Queen Street, Perth, and Pitlochry in around 11h 8m.
